115514 MATHEMATICS: PROPERTIES OF NUMBER (UNIT 1)

In successfully completing this unit, the Learner will have

Evidence needed

demonstrated the ability to

1put into order at least six whole numbers of up to seven digits, including positive and negative numbersSummary sheet and/or student completed work
2choose the appropriate operation, ie addition, subtraction, multiplication or division, to solve given whole number problems both with and without a calculatorSummary sheet and/or student completed work
3solve at least two multi-step calculator problems using the BIDMAS (brackets, indices, division, multiplication, addition, subtraction) methodSummary sheet and/or student completed work
4solve given problems using equivalent and mixed number fractionsSummary sheet and/or student completed work
5solve a minimum of two problems involving fractions using each of the four operations both with and without a calculator Summary sheet and/or student completed work
6solve at least two problems involving decimals using each of the four operations both with and without a calculator and rounding answers where necessary.Summary sheet and/or student completed work

All outcomes recorded on an AQA Summary Sheet
